RC 1 is now available for testing. Changes since Beta 3: 1) The ''show'' command -b (brief) option now also omits chains that have no rules listed. 2) A CHECKSUM action has been added to the tcrules files. This action computes and fills in the checksum in a packet that lacks one. This is particularly useful, if you need to work around old applications such as dhcp clients, that do not work well with checksum offloads, but don''t want to disable checksum offload in your device. As part of this change, a new ''Checksum Target'' capability has been added, so if you use a capabilities file, it needs to be re-generated after you install this release. 3) The ''shorewall6 show routing'' command now sorts the contents of each routing table in the same way as ''shorewall show routing''. 4) It is now possible to specify a mark range in the ACTION column of the tcrules file. This causes the generated ruleset to assign marks in the range in round-robin fashion. As part of this change, a STATE column is also added that allows marks to be assigned only to packets that are in one of the specified states (NEW, RELATED, ESTABLISHED, etc.). Specifying NEW in this column along with a range in the ACTION column allows for load-balancing SNAT rules over a number of different external addresses. Example: /etc/shorewall/tcrules #ACTION SOURCE DEST ... 1-3:CF eth1 172.20.1.0/24 ; state=NEW /etc/shorewall/masq #INTERFACE SOURCE ADDRESS ... eth0 192.168.1.0/24 1.1.1.1 ; mark=1:C eth0 192.168.1.0/24 1.1.1.5 ; mark=2:C eth0 192.168.1.0/24 1.1.1.9 ; mark=3:C Specifying a mark range require the ''Statistics Match'' capability in your iptables and kernel.
